From 5d28a8962dcb6ec056b81d730e3c6fb57185a210 Mon Sep 17 00:00:00 2001 From: Florian Weimer Date: Tue, 28 Dec 2021 22:52:56 +0100 Subject: elf: Add _dl_find_object function It can be used to speed up the libgcc unwinder, and the internal _dl_find_dso_for_object function (which is used for caller identification in dlopen and related functions, and in dladdr). _dl_find_object is in the internal namespace due to bug 28503. If libgcc switches to _dl_find_object, this namespace issue will be fixed. It is located in libc for two reasons: it is necessary to forward the call to the static libc after static dlopen, and there is a link ordering issue with -static-libgcc and libgcc_eh.a because libc.so is not a linker script that includes ld.so in the glibc build tree (so that GCC's internal -lc after libgcc_eh.a does not pick up ld.so). It is necessary to do the i386 customization in the sysdeps/x86/bits/dl_find_object.h header shared with x86-64 because otherwise, multilib installations are broken. The implementation uses software transactional memory, as suggested by Torvald Riegel. Two copies of the supporting data structures are used, also achieving full async-signal-safety.
